Download 2002 maruti zen lx 1l 60ps pov test drive 72 revlimits

Duration: (17:8)



2002 maruti zen lx 1l 60ps pov test drive 72 revlimits 2002 maruti zen lx 1l 60ps pov test drive 72 revlimits 2002 maruti zen lx 1l 60ps pov test drive 72 revlimits

Description
Download this and online watch 2002 maruti zen lx 1l 60ps pov test drive 72 revlimits
Related videos

Mxtube.net